WebNov 9, 2016 · Buy&Bill is for PROFITABLEdrugs/treatments. Your Discounted Cost (cost after discounts, rebates, etc) and direct infusion labor cost (Infusion Nurse) must be less than your payer reimbursement for this to work. Ask if the provider accepted assignment for the service. Ask how much is still owed and, if necessary, discuss a payment plan. WebFeb 2, 2024 · Buy and Bill. The term "buy and bill" refers to a provider purchasing the medication from an FDA approved, reputable source and then supplying the (typically) medication along with the service. The other option is to give the patient a prescription (if the medication CAN be purchased by the patient) or send a script to a specialty pharmacy.
